Summary
"The founder and director of the Thirty Million Words Initiative, Professor Dana Suskind, explains why the most important--and astoundingly simple--thing you can do for your child's future success in life is to talk to him or her, reveals the recent science behind this truth, and outlines precisely how parents can best put it into practice" --, provided by publisher
Table Of Contents
Connections : why a pediatric cochlear implant surgeon became a social scientist -- The first word : the pioneers of parent talk -- Neuroplasticity : riding the revolutionary wave in brain science -- The power of parent talk : from language to an outlook on life -- The three Ts : setting the stage for optimum brain development -- The social consequences : where the science of neuroplasticity can take us -- Spreading the words : the next step -- Epilogue: Stepping off the shoreline
